The Fluor Daniel Process Design Manual is a widely used and respected guide in the field of process design and engineering. Developed by Fluor Daniel, a leading global engineering and construction company, this manual provides a comprehensive framework for designing and optimizing industrial processes. In this article, we will explore the Fluor Daniel Process Design Manual, its history, contents, and significance in the field of process design.
It ensures that whether a refinery is being designed in Houston or Haarlem, the core engineering calculations and safety margins remain consistent.
In large-scale engineering, procurement, and construction (EPC) projects, having a unified design language is critical. The Fluor Daniel manual serves as a bridge between high-level engineering theory and practical, field-ready application.
